POTASSIUM CAPRYLATE.

Valuable

Potassium Caprylate is a potassium salt of caprylic acid, a medium-chain fatty acid known for its versatile applications in skincare. It acts as an effective emulsifier, stabilizing formulations while also offering mild preservative, skin conditioning, and antimicrobial benefits.

Science

As a potassium salt of caprylic acid, Potassium Caprylate primarily functions by disrupting the cell membranes of certain fungi and bacteria, thereby exerting antimicrobial and antifungal effects. In formulations, it acts as an emulsifier by reducing the surface tension between immiscible liquids, ensuring product stability. It also contributes to skin conditioning, leaving the skin feeling soft and smooth.

Stability

Potassium Caprylate exhibits stability under standard storage conditions, maintaining a stable shelf life of two years when stored in a cool, dry environment within a tightly sealed container. A 10% solution of Potassium Caprylate typically has a pH ranging from 8.5 to 10.5.

Safety

CIR Status
Safe with restrictions
Sensitization risk Low

The Cosmetic Ingredient Review (CIR) Panel has deemed fatty acids and their salts, including Potassium Caprylate, safe for cosmetic use when formulations are developed to be non-irritating and non-sensitizing. While there is no specific maximum concentration set for Potassium Caprylate by CIR, similar fatty acid salts used as preservatives may have restrictions (e.g., 0.2% as acid). The US FDA recognizes Caprylic Acid (its parent acid) as Generally Recognized As Safe (GRAS) for food use, and Potassium Caprylate is also considered a safe food additive.
